    Cafe culture, beautiful views, charming and vibrant town sq...

    Cafe culture, beautiful views, charming and vibrant town sq with weekly market. Tranquil. Too much to see in one day. Take a two hour electric hire boat with a picnic down the river. Eat Moules until you can't move and relax.

    Charming place, especially the port.

    Charming place, especially the port. No boats - while we were there -to St Malo because of the tides, as the river is tidal up to Dinan. The older part is almost traffic free. Fascinating shops, deli's, market on Thursday.
